Grain size of Quaternary sediments in the continental shelf-margin: implications for paleo-environment in the Northwestern South China Sea

IntroductionThe quantitative distribution of grain size of sediments could imply the hydrodynamic conditions as well as terrestrial material composition; and thus, it is indicative of sea-level fluctuations, regional sources and climate changes.
